Berlin Pride Attack: Outrage Follows Alleged Attacker's Troubling Background
The recent attack during Berlin Pride has left the community in shock and mourning, igniting fierce debate over why the alleged attacker was not incarcerated. Reports suggest his previous offenses should have warranted a prison sentence, but systemic failures allowed him to walk free. Citizens are left demanding accountability from the authorities: What went wrong in the justice system? Why was he not monitored?
This incident comes at a time when the LGBTQ+ community faces increasing threats, and many are questioning the effectiveness of safety measures in place during such significant events. The outcry for answers underscores a broader call for reform in the handling of repeat offenders and the protection of marginalized groups. As reported by BBC News, the public's anger and grief are palpable, with many demanding immediate action from local and national authorities to ensure safety and justice for all.
